Real Steel director Shawn Levy wants to put an end to Hugh Jackman and Ryan Reynolds' faux feud and reunite the two actors for a sequel. The 2011 sci-fi action film told the story of Charlie Kenton, a former boxer who was trying to make ends meet by robot boxing. When Charlie learned that he had a son, he decided to get custody and the two bonded over the sport. Later, they discovered an obsolete sparring robot named Atom, who they used to enter competitions. Hugh Jackman starred in the lead role along with Anthony Mckie, Evangeline Lily, and Dakota Goyo.

Jackman and Reynolds have not shared the big screen since 2009 for X-Men Origins: Wolverine, where the latter was first introduced as Wade Wilson a.k.a. Deadpool. The two actors developed a notorious friendship and often displayed their rivalry on social media for fun. Aside from appearing in the superhero films, Jackman and Reynolds have Levy as another thing in common. The director's latest movie is Reynolds' sci-fi comedy Free Guy, which is slated to hit theaters on Aug. 13. If it were up to Levy, a dream project would be directing the two superstars together in one movie.

In a recent interview with ComicBook, Levy said that he wants to reunite Jackman and Reynolds for a Real Steel sequel. According to Levy, a Real Steel 2 is something he's always discussed with Jackman, and it will be interesting if he could get Reynolds to star in it as well. Levy's full quote can be read below:

Well, I'll say this, Hugh and I definitely are feeling, we've never stopped feeling the love for Real Steel, and it's almost like the volume has been increasing. Hugh and I were together literally last week talking about that. So I would never say never on that, a sequel for Real Steal. Additionally, I'm friends with Hugh. I'm friends with Ryan. I will get them together. Whether it's in Real Steel or another movie, I will direct those two amazing guys and dear friends in a movie together.

While it's been 10 years since Real Steel was released, the sports drama is enjoying a renewed interest among audiences after it dropped on Netflix last year. It climbed the streaming platform's Top 10 most-viewed titles at the height of the pandemic, so developing Real Steel 2 now while the clamor is high is a great idea. The first movie was a huge commercial hit, earning almost $300 million at the box office, which is another reason why a sequel should be considered by Disney.

If Real Steel 2 does push through, it is almost certain that Jackman will reprise his role. The only question is, will Levy be able to convince the Deadpool actor to do the film? A Jackman-Reynolds reunion movie is one that's sure to draw viewers, especially since the two actors have been trending on the internet for their funny banters. Because Jackman has retired his Wolverine claws, it seems unlikely for them to do another X-Men or any Marvel film together. However, a reunion for a Real Steel sequel is very possible and will surely make for one entertaining blockbuster.
